What more can I say? Well, a lot actually. Pho Viet Anh is a wonderful little restaurant I would recommend to anyone. My wife and I have tried numerous items off of the menu and not been disappointed once. The pho is excellent and authentic. The service is warm and embracing. Henry, the proprieter, goes out of his way to make every one of his customers feel welcome and special. Where typically pho restaurants have focused on economical and quick food, Henry has stepped the market up a notch. Look out Tahn Bros. The restaurant is clean, the food is of excellent quality and the service is unparalleled. I can only hope that this level of quality does not decline. They have set themselves apart from the crowd.

My girlfriend and I recently discovered Pho Viet Anh.

Since discovering this jewel, we have dined there over a dozen times. This is one of our favorite restaurants. It is affordable, fast, friendly, and an all around great dining experience.

Henry and Carol own the restaurant and obviously take great pride in their establishment. The restaurant is cozy, in the evening the lighting and tapestries create a romantic environment.

When we visit, Henry greets us by name and makes us feel at home. We like to start with some hot tea while trying to decide what to order. In our many visits, we have ordered most of the vegetarian and chicken dishes.

The chicken and vegetarian Pho are delicious. The Vegetarian Fresh Spring Rolls are amazing. The chicken and vegetarian curry dishes are to die for. Yesterday I ordered the Lemongrass Chicken, which I loved.

If you are looking for a great place for Vietnamese food, this is the place.

This is one of my favorite restaurants in Lower Queen Anne. The Pho is good and there is a wide variety of vegetarian fare. Their vegetarian pho is a rarity in that it is completely vege, no chicken broth. The staff, Henry and Carol, are super nice and friendly and the food is a great value. Their deck is a great place to sit outside and enjoy a beer or white wine with some yummy Vietnamese food. Enjoy!
